HC Deb 19 November 1973 vol 864 c358W
Mr. Barry Jones

asked the Secretary of State for Wales if, in view of the proposed rundown of Shotton steelworks in East Flintshire, he will review his plans to close the existing cottage hospitals and sanction extensions of existing physical health hospitals; and if he will make a statement.

Mr. Peter Thomas

Hospital provision in the area will constinue to be decided on the health requirements of the population as a whole. The Welsh Hospital Board has been considering the future pattern of hospital services in North-East Wales after completion of the new district general hospital near Rhyl, and will shortly be commencing formal local consultations on its proposals. These provide for the Flint and Holywell Cottage Hospitals to continue in use. When the board has completed its consultations, formal proposals will be put to me for approval.
